Personally, I'd hesitate to even call Splash a "thrill" ride, since the drop at the end is really more of a visual thing instead of an actual physical thrill.

Splash is an amazing, intricate, immersive AA-laden experience that is (IMHO) the last great attraction built at WDW.

Space is two old mouse coasters from the 1970's run next to each other in the dark, shaking you back and forth.

Physically, Splash is much tamer - and IMHO a much better ride.
